2022-04-25 23:24:32 +00:00
|
|
|
@echo off
|
|
|
|
|
2022-04-27 03:50:32 +00:00
|
|
|
:: This binary is the SSL-secure release
|
2022-04-27 03:56:41 +00:00
|
|
|
set SSL_BINARY_URL="https://github.com/SpikeHD/neutralinojs/releases/download/v420.69.0/neutralino-win_x64.exe"
|
|
|
|
set NON_SSL_BINARY_URL="https://github.com/SpikeHD/neutralinojs/releases/download/v1337.0.0/neutralino-win_x64.exe"
|
2022-04-27 03:50:32 +00:00
|
|
|
|
2022-04-25 23:24:32 +00:00
|
|
|
:: Clean dist folder
|
|
|
|
del /s /q /f .\dist
|
|
|
|
rd /s /q .\dist
|
|
|
|
|
2022-04-27 03:50:32 +00:00
|
|
|
:: Get the SSL-secure version of the binary
|
2022-04-27 03:56:41 +00:00
|
|
|
powershell Invoke-WebRequest -Uri %SSL_BINARY_URL% -OutFile "./bin/neutralino-win_x64.exe"
|
2022-04-27 03:50:32 +00:00
|
|
|
|
2022-04-25 23:24:32 +00:00
|
|
|
:: build
|
|
|
|
call neu build
|
|
|
|
|
|
|
|
:: Copy scripts and langs
|
2022-04-25 23:32:19 +00:00
|
|
|
xcopy .\languages\ .\dist\GrassClipper\languages\ /y /s
|
2022-04-25 23:24:32 +00:00
|
|
|
xcopy .\proxy\ .\dist\GrassClipper\proxy\ /y /s
|
|
|
|
xcopy .\scripts\ .\dist\GrassClipper\scripts\ /y /s
|
|
|
|
|
|
|
|
:: bgs
|
|
|
|
mkdir .\dist\GrassClipper\resources\bg\private
|
|
|
|
mkdir .\dist\GrassClipper\resources\bg\server
|
|
|
|
xcopy .\resources\bg\private\ .\dist\GrassClipper\resources\bg\private\ /y /s
|
|
|
|
xcopy .\resources\bg\server\ .\dist\GrassClipper\resources\bg\server\ /y /s
|
|
|
|
|
|
|
|
:: rename exe
|
2022-04-27 03:56:41 +00:00
|
|
|
move .\dist\GrassClipper\GrassClipper-win_x64.exe .\dist\GrassClipper\GrassClipper.exe
|
|
|
|
|
|
|
|
:: Re-use non-ssl secure version
|
2022-04-30 05:30:14 +00:00
|
|
|
powershell Invoke-WebRequest -Uri %NON_SSL_BINARY_URL% -OutFile "./bin/neutralino-win_x64.exe"
|